Summary
This position functions as General Production for the Bindery Department. Duties include : feeding the stitcher pockets with the correct product and ensuring the operation runs smoothly; sorting product by zip codes and checking the quality of the stitched and addressed product; and stacking books evenly in a timely fashion on pallets or skids. The position also includes working with others in the company to provide the highest level of customer service.
Essential Duties and Responsibilities
- Follow all safety policies and guidelines.
- Help to reach company’s customer service, profit, sales, and growth goals.
- Continually communicate with the bindery operator on the performance of the current job.
- Stack books evenly on a pallet / skid.
- Insert the two skid tags in the shrink-warp of the pallets / skids for shipping.
- Make sure information is correct on the tags for the skids or mail cages.
- Tie bundles together straight and even.
- Watch for jam-ups and miss-feeds on the machine.
- Efficiently feed the pockets with the printed materials as needed.
- Move pallets or skids as needed.
- Inspect product brought to the machine to ensure accuracy.
- When reading, verify all information on the address is correct and legible.
- Check finished product for trimmed off type and ensure books are stitched and trimmed straight.
- Shrink-wrap pallets / skids for shipping.
- Verify correct information is placed on the pallet, skid or cage tag.
- Insert skid tags in the shrink-wrap of the pallets / skids for shipping.
- Ensure information is correct on the tags for the skids or mail cages.
- Changing strap reel.
- Keep area around the machines and skids clean of unnecessary items.
